Abstract
The utility model relates to the technical field of landscaping engineering, and discloses irrigation equipment with an adjusting structure, which comprises an irrigation machine, wherein universal wheels are fixedly arranged at the bottom of the irrigation machine, a water tank is fixedly arranged in the irrigation machine, a movable assembly is arranged in the irrigation machine, and the movable assembly comprises: the motor, motor fixed mounting is in the inside of irrigating the machine, motor output shaft top fixed mounting has a conical gear I, conical gear I top meshing has a conical gear II, conical gear II inside fixed mounting has the pivot, the pivot rotates to be connected on the inner wall of irrigating the machine, this irrigation equipment with adjusting structure, can utilize movable part, go to irrigate its irrigator that can the multi-angle when spraying water to great improvement staff convenience at work, increase the practicality and the use persistence of irrigator, improve the spraying efficiency and the quality of irrigator.

Technical Field
The utility model relates to the technical field of landscaping engineering, in particular to irrigation equipment with an adjusting structure.
Background
With the progress of modern technology, more and more agricultural equipment is used for agricultural production, so that the agricultural production efficiency is improved, the irrigation equipment is one of the necessary devices in the agricultural production process, and the agricultural irrigation mode can be generally divided into traditional ground irrigation, common sprinkling irrigation and micro-irrigation, and traditional ground irrigation comprises furrow irrigation, flood irrigation and flood irrigation.
But the current irrigation equipment that is used for afforestation engineering to have regulation structure can not adjust the angle of its shower nozzle water spray, leads to its irrigation machine's water spray effect not comprehensive to make it reduce the practicality of irrigation machine.

In the figure: 1. an irrigation machine; 2. a universal wheel; 3. a water tank; 4. a movable assembly; 41. a motor; 42. a first conical gear; 43. a second bevel gear; 44. a rotating shaft; 45. a movable shaft; 46. a fixed block; 47. a movable block; 48. a movable ball; 49. a movable rod; 410. a watering bar; 411. a water conduit; 412. a telescopic rod; 413. a spray head.
Detailed Description
As shown in fig. 1-3, the present utility model provides a technical solution: irrigation equipment with adjust structure, including irrigator 1, irrigator 1 bottom fixed mounting has universal wheel 2, and irrigator 1 inside fixed mounting has water tank 3, and irrigator 1 inside is provided with movable assembly 4, can utilize movable assembly 4, can go to irrigate its irrigator 1 when the water spray can the multi-angle, and movable assembly 4 includes: the motor 41, the motor 41 is fixedly installed in the irrigation machine 1, the top of the output shaft of the motor 41 is fixedly provided with a first bevel gear 42, the first bevel gear 42 drives the second bevel gear 43 to move when moving, the second bevel gear 43 drives the rotating shaft 44 to move when moving, the rotating shaft 44 drives the movable shaft 45 to move when moving, the movable block 47 drives the movable ball 48 to rotate left and right when moving, the movable ball 48 drives the movable rod 49 to move when moving, the movable rod 49 drives the sprinkling rod 410 to move when moving, the sprinkling rod 410 drives the telescopic rod 412 to move when moving, the first bevel gear 42 is meshed with the second bevel gear 43, the rotating shaft 44 is fixedly installed in the second bevel gear 43, and the rotating shaft 44 is rotationally connected on the inner wall of the irrigation machine 1, the surface of the rotating shaft 44 is connected with a movable shaft 45 through belt transmission, the movable shaft 45 is rotationally connected on the inner wall of the irrigation machine 1, the surface of the movable shaft 45 is provided with a fixed block 46, the fixed block 46 is fixedly arranged in the irrigation machine 1, the movable shaft 45 penetrates through the fixed block 46, the right side of the movable shaft 45 is fixedly provided with a movable block 47, a movable ball 48 is rotationally connected in the movable block 47, the right side of the movable ball 48 is fixedly provided with a movable rod 49, the right side of the movable rod 49 is fixedly provided with a sprinkling rod 410, the bottom of the sprinkling rod 410 is fixedly provided with a water guide pipe 411, the water guide pipe 411 is slidingly connected in the water tank 3, the right side of the sprinkling rod 410 is fixedly provided with a telescopic rod 412, the length of a spray head 413 of the telescopic rod 412 can be adjusted, the right side of the telescopic rod 412 is fixedly provided with the spray head 413, thereby greatly improving the convenience of workers in work, the practicability and the use durability of the irrigation machine 1, the spraying efficiency and the quality of the irrigation machine 1 are improved, holes are formed in the surface of the spray head 413, grooves are formed in the movable block 47, the movable ball 48 can rotate in the movable block 47 through the grooves in the movable block 47, so that angle movement is achieved, the cross section of the movable block 47 is L-shaped, a chute is formed in the irrigation machine 1, and the cross section of the movable ball 48 is circular.
Working principle: when the irrigation machine 1 sprays the water at multiple angles, the motor 41 can drive the first bevel gear 42 to move, the first bevel gear 42 can drive the second bevel gear 43 to move, the second bevel gear 43 can drive the second rotary shaft 44 to move, the rotary shaft 44 can drive the movable shaft 45 to move, the movable shaft 45 can drive the movable block 47 to move, the movable block 47 can drive the movable ball 48 to rotate left and right, the movable ball 48 can drive the movable rod 49 to move, the movable rod 49 can drive the sprinkler rod 410 to move, the sprinkler rod 410 can drive the telescopic rod 412 to move, and the telescopic rod 412 can drive the sprinkler head 413 to move, so that the convenience of workers in work can be greatly improved, the practicability and the use duration of the irrigation machine 1 can be improved, and the sprinkling efficiency and quality of the irrigation machine 1 can be improved.
